Tel Aviv: Syria must cut ties with groups like Hezbollah and Hamas and distance itself from Iran if wants to reach peace with Israel, the Jewish state said on Thursday.
Israeli Foreign Minister Tzipi Livni said :"Israel wants to live in peace with its neighbours but Syria also needs to understand that it needs also full renunciation of supporting terror - Hezbollah, Hamas and of course Iran."
These remarks come one day after both countries confirmed they were conducting indirect peace talks.
Livni called Syria's ties with Iran “problematic,'' a reference to the belief that the Islamic Republic supports Hezbollah and Hamas.
Israel's comments echo US demands that Syria severe ties from what it considers terrorist organisations.
